Japan Cybersecurity AI Market By Type Segment Analysis
The Japan Cybersecurity AI market segmentation by type primarily encompasses Threat Detection & Prevention, Security Analytics, Identity & Access Management, and Incident Response solutions. Threat Detection & Prevention remains the dominant segment, leveraging advanced AI algorithms to identify and mitigate cyber threats in real-time. This segment is characterized by its maturity and widespread adoption across financial institutions, government agencies, and large enterprises. Security Analytics, which involves the use of AI-driven data analysis to uncover vulnerabilities and predict potential attack vectors, is rapidly gaining traction, driven by increasing cyber incident volumes and regulatory compliance demands. Identity & Access Management solutions utilize AI to enhance authentication processes, reduce fraud, and streamline user access controls, increasingly vital amid rising remote work trends. Incident Response, integrating AI for automated threat mitigation and response orchestration, is an emerging segment with significant growth potential, especially as organizations seek faster, more efficient breach handling capabilities.
Market size estimates for the Japan Cybersecurity AI Type segments project a total market valuation of approximately USD 1.2 billion in 2023. Threat Detection & Prevention accounts for roughly 45% of this market, reflecting its maturity and critical role in cybersecurity infrastructure. Security Analytics contributes around 25%, with rapid growth fueled by data-driven security strategies. Identity & Access Management holds an estimated 20%, with increasing demand from sectors prioritizing user identity security. Incident Response, though currently smaller at about 10%, is expected to grow at a CAGR of approximately 20% over the next five years, driven by the need for automated, rapid response solutions. The fastest-growing segment is Incident Response, transitioning from emerging to a growth stage, supported by technological innovations such as AI-powered automation and orchestration tools. Overall, the market is in a growth phase, with innovation accelerating adoption across various segments, driven by rising cyber threats and regulatory pressures.

Japan Cybersecurity AI Market By Application Segment Analysis
The application segmentation of the Japan Cybersecurity AI market includes Network Security, Endpoint Security, Cloud Security, Data Security, and Compliance & Risk Management. Network Security remains the largest application segment, utilizing AI to monitor, detect, and respond to network-based threats proactively. This segment benefits from the increasing complexity of network infrastructures and the proliferation of IoT devices, which expand attack surfaces. Endpoint Security, focusing on securing devices such as laptops, mobile phones, and servers, is gaining importance as remote working becomes mainstream. Cloud Security, driven by the rapid adoption of cloud services, leverages AI to safeguard cloud environments against evolving threats, making it a high-growth segment. Data Security, which involves protecting sensitive data through AI-enabled encryption, anomaly detection, and access controls, is increasingly prioritized by organizations handling large volumes of critical information. Compliance & Risk Management solutions, integrating AI to automate regulatory adherence and risk assessment, are emerging as vital tools amid tightening cybersecurity regulations and the need for continuous monitoring.
Market estimates suggest that Network Security accounts for approximately 50% of the total cybersecurity AI application market in Japan, reflecting its critical role in safeguarding enterprise and government networks. Cloud Security is the fastest-growing application segment, with an estimated CAGR of 18% over the next five years, driven by the exponential increase in cloud adoption and the need for sophisticated AI-driven security measures. Data Security and Endpoint Security each constitute around 15-20% of the market, with steady growth supported by remote work trends and data privacy regulations. Compliance & Risk Management, while currently smaller at about 10%, is expected to witness accelerated growth, fueled by increasing regulatory requirements and the need for automated compliance monitoring. The market is transitioning from emerging to growing stages across most application segments, with technological advancements in AI-enabled threat detection, behavioral analytics, and automated response systems acting as key growth accelerators. These innovations are enabling organizations to adopt more proactive and scalable cybersecurity measures, aligning with the evolving threat landscape.
